Lots of nad, uses up energy, body responds to that (signal to the cell to activate sirtuins) Sirtuins can affect many organs in positive ways. Insilin sensitivity, fatty acid oxidation, less sensitive (insulin resistance, diabetes is not a problem) Oxidative stress (as we age, we get more of this) and affects sit ruin activity (activity decreases) Nad increases with exercise and eating less, increasing sirtuin activity. Nad decreases with aging (or high-fat diet), decreasing sirtuin activity. Boost certain vitamins (vitamin b3) to boost levels of nad in cells (can be done in mice) Muscle cells have lots of mitochondria (to make atp) Stem cells do not participate (depend on glycolysis for energy, do not need much atp) Help signal to the cell (positive things), alters how stem cells function = important. Nicotinamide riboside = add nad to the cell. Increases number of neuronal stem cells (more activity and more stem cells that divide and replace old cells), better brain function.
